Executive Board Resolution
On Saturday, February 16, the WCDP Executive Board passed a resolution calling for an enhanced COVID-19 response for Black Washtenaw County residents. Visit our website to view the resolution.

From the League of Women Voters
On Friday, February 26 from 12:00 p.m. to 1:30 p.m., the LWV will be holding a “Virtual Lunch & Learn” focusing on the COVID response in Michigan. Register for this event and learn more about its guest speakers here.


The LWV’s next “Virtual Brews & Views” will be on Wednesday, March 10 from 7: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m. The focus will be on the U.S. healthcare system, particularly how it impacts low-income Americans, immigrants, and people of color, especially black Americans.
